Confused civil or criminal

i have purchased a car from a dealer made half of the payments lost my job and kinda liad low for acouple of months til i found work and got back on my feet. Dealer called my mother and said they were going to press charges for cat theft. Now isnt this a civil matter because the car was not stolen?

Default Re: civil or criminal

Normally yes it would be civil unless you are hiding the car and purposely not paying. But a couple of months is normally not criminal.
